Web1: The Read-Only Web (1991-2004)
The first web was static. Websites were digital brochures โ HTML pages with text and images you could read but not interact with. Content creators were few (requiring technical knowledge), consumers were many. Yahoo directories and GeoCities defined this era.
๐ WEB1 CHARACTERISTICS
Static HTML pages. No user accounts. Open protocols (HTTP, SMTP, FTP). Decentralised by default โ anyone could host a server. No advertising model. Content owned by creators.
Web2: The Social Web (2004-2020)
Web2 made everyone a content creator. Facebook, YouTube, Twitter enabled billions to publish without technical knowledge. But platforms own your data, control distribution, and monetise your attention through ads. You are the product.
Web2 Wins
Universal publishing. Social connectivity. App economies. Cloud computing. Mobile-first. Real-time communication.
Web2 Failures
Data harvesting. Censorship power. Platform dependency. No data portability. Privacy erosion. Creator exploitation.
Web3: The Ownership Web (2020+)
Web3 combines Web1's open protocols with Web2's rich interactivity โ but with user ownership. Instead of signing in with Google, you sign in with your wallet. Your digital identity, social graph, and assets are portable across applications.
Decentralised Identity
Your wallet IS your identity. No platform can ban you. Reputation and credentials travel with you across all apps.
Token Economics
Users earn tokens for contributing value. Early adopters rewarded. Governance tokens give users voting power over platforms.
Composability
"Money Legos" โ combine DeFi protocols like building blocks. Apps built on shared protocols interoperate without APIs.
Censorship Resistance
No entity can deplatform you or seize assets. Content on IPFS/Arweave is permanent. Smart contracts execute regardless of politics.
Key Web3 Infrastructure
Web3 is a stack of decentralised technologies replacing centralised services across every internet layer.
Computation โ Ethereum, Solana, Polkadot
Decentralised smart contract execution replaces centralised servers. Code runs on distributed networks no entity controls.
Storage โ IPFS, Arweave, Filecoin
Decentralised file storage replaces AWS S3. Data distributed across thousands of nodes. Permanent, censorship-resistant.
Identity โ ENS, Lens Protocol, Spruce
Decentralised identity replaces Google/Facebook login. Own your username, social graph, and credentials across all apps.
Oracles โ Chainlink, Pyth, API3
Bridge real-world data to blockchains. Price feeds, weather, sports โ any external data smart contracts need.
Challenges and Criticism
Web3 faces legitimate challenges: poor UX (managing keys), scalability limitations, and regulatory uncertainty. Critics argue many "decentralised" projects are controlled by small groups of token holders.
โ ๏ธ HONEST ASSESSMENT
Web3 today is where the internet was in 1995 โ clunky, slow, mostly used by enthusiasts. UX needs to improve 10x before mainstream adoption. Account abstraction, social recovery wallets, and gasless transactions are addressing this, but we are still early.
The Road Ahead
Web3 will not replace Web2 overnight โ it will gradually absorb it. The transition will be invisible. You will start using applications that run on decentralised infrastructure, offer better creator economics, and give you ownership of your data.
